Got out today

Finally the weather broke I've been rained on for three weeks..It was kinda windy today..in my face at the range & some gusts coming from the left..Mirage was there but managable..I got to shoot alot of loads I had been waiting to try out..The 100 grain Sierra looks very promising I only loaded 3 at each level but I think it could be a good bullet in my gun...I shot one really sweet .299 5 shot group with an 88gr berger match bullet....The Berger 80 gr.MEF HP shot under a half inch, got the 75 grain v-max looking decent also but that bullet has fooled me before..good at 100 [5/8 inch] 200 yds no go..the 75 gr hornady hollow point shot decent also all my shooting today was at 100 yds..I'll load some more & see what holds together at 200yds next trip out.I cleaned the gun before shooting today.There was nothing in there after 75 shots..no copper & very little carbon..I pushed 3 wet then 3 dry patches thru there last wet one was Kroil/hoppes 50/50 Then only one dry patch...I really like that little gun... .pics attached...mike in ct

I got to the range today in Connecticut as well. I shot my old 40X in 6mm Intl. The primary bullet that I shot was the 65 gr VMax and with loads on the light side. The only purpose of this rifle is for 200 yd position iron sight competition.

In the past I have used the 75 gr Sierra HP and 3031 with good luck but I like the plastic meplats these days. The powder that I hoped would work out is 4759 and it did ok but IMR 4198 with a hotter charge was quite a bit better.

Over all it was a very good day at the range. The groups were estimated and no targets marked. For this shooting a 1/2 MOA is all that one needs.

I don't clean this bore. It has to go at least 140 shots or so per match when it's the full course. I find that cleaning does not matter that much with light loads.
